Chopstick Coleslaw
By prairiemama
Chow mein noodles and peanut sauce add Asian flair to traditional coleslaw. Chopstick Coleslaw is just as good as take-out!

Ingredients
- 1 (10-ounce) package cooked sliced chicken
- 1 (16-ounce) package shredded coleslaw mix
- 1/2 small red onion, thinly sliced
- 3 tablespoons chopped fresh cilantro
- 1/2 cup Asian or peanut dressing
- 1/2 cup salted peanuts or chow mein noodles
Details
Servings 4
Adapted from mrfood.com
Preparation
Step 1
1. In a large bowl, combine the chicken, coleslaw mix,
onion, and cilantro; mix well.
2. Add the dressing and toss until evenly coated.
3.Sprinkle with peanuts or chow mein noodles, and
serve
*You can use2 cups cut-up leftover chicken instead of the packaged chicken, or use shrimp, diced ham or roast
beef
